1. Generator Dimension (kW)

Generator dimension, measured in kilowatts (kW), instantly correlates with price. Bigger mills, able to powering extra home equipment and units concurrently, command greater costs. A home-owner needing to run solely important circuits throughout an outage, equivalent to a fridge, furnace, and some lights, would possibly require a smaller, inexpensive generator (e.g., 7 kW). Conversely, whole-house protection, together with air con, a number of home equipment, and electronics, necessitates a bigger, extra pricey unit (e.g., 22 kW or greater). This relationship between energy output and worth displays the elevated materials and manufacturing prices related to higher-capacity mills.

Deciding on the suitable generator dimension requires cautious consideration of energy wants. Oversizing a generator leads to pointless expense, whereas undersizing results in inadequate energy throughout an outage. Conducting a radical dwelling power evaluation helps decide the required kW capability. This evaluation includes calculating the wattage of important home equipment and units, making certain the chosen generator can deal with the anticipated load. On-line assets and certified electricians can help with these calculations, facilitating knowledgeable decision-making.

2. Gasoline Sort

Gasoline sort considerably influences Generac generator price, each initially and over time. Frequent gasoline choices embody pure fuel, propane, and diesel. Pure fuel, typically available through current dwelling fuel traces, usually includes decrease working prices. Nevertheless, reliance on a utility connection presents a vulnerability throughout widespread outages the place fuel provide could also be disrupted. Propane, saved in tanks, affords gasoline independence however requires periodic refills and entails greater gasoline bills in comparison with pure fuel. Diesel mills, whereas providing glorious gasoline effectivity and longer run occasions, usually contain greater upfront prices and require common upkeep. The chosen gasoline sort impacts not solely the generator’s buy worth but in addition long-term operational bills.

The situation and availability of gasoline sources affect gasoline sort choice. Properties with current pure fuel connections could discover pure fuel mills essentially the most handy choice. In areas the place pure fuel is unavailable or unreliable, propane affords a sensible different. For functions requiring prolonged run occasions and gasoline effectivity, diesel typically presents essentially the most appropriate alternative, regardless of greater upfront prices. Evaluating gasoline availability, price per unit, and anticipated utilization patterns permits shoppers to make knowledgeable choices aligning with particular person wants and budgets. As an example, a distant cabin would possibly profit from a propane-fueled generator attributable to its off-grid location, whereas a suburban dwelling with a pure fuel connection would possibly prioritize the decrease working prices of a pure fuel generator.

3. Set up Complexity

Set up complexity considerably influences the general price of a Generac generator system. Components equivalent to location, current electrical infrastructure, and native allowing necessities contribute to various set up bills. Understanding these complexities permits for correct budgeting and knowledgeable decision-making.

  • Website Preparation and Accessibility

    Leveling the bottom, pouring a concrete pad, and making certain correct drainage are essential web site preparation steps that affect price. Troublesome-to-access areas, equivalent to rooftops or areas requiring intensive excavation, enhance labor and materials bills. Places with readily accessible utility connections and degree floor usually simplify set up, minimizing prices.

  • Electrical Connections and Wiring

    Connecting the generator to the house’s electrical system and putting in a switch change require specialised electrical work. The complexity of the prevailing electrical panel, distance between the generator and the panel, and the necessity for trenching and conduit set up contribute to price variations. Properties with outdated electrical methods would possibly require upgrades to accommodate the generator, including to the general expense.

  • Allowing and Inspections

    Acquiring essential permits and scheduling inspections add time and expense to the set up course of. Allowing necessities differ by location and might contain charges and adherence to particular native codes. Navigating these rules and making certain compliance contributes to the general mission price.

  • Gasoline Line or Propane Tank Set up

    Gasoline supply set up provides one other layer of complexity and price. Pure fuel mills require connection to an current fuel line or the set up of a brand new line, probably involving excavation and specialised plumbing work. Propane-fueled mills necessitate the set up of a propane tank, which incorporates tank buy or lease, placement, and connection. These fuel-related installations contribute considerably to the general mission finances.

4. Switch Swap Sort

Switch switches play a vital function in Generac generator methods, safely connecting the generator to the house’s electrical circuits. The selection of switch change sort considerably impacts the general system price. Understanding the several types of switch switches and their related prices permits for knowledgeable decision-making.

  • Guide Switch Switches

    Guide switch switches supply a extra budget-friendly choice. They require guide operation, involving bodily transferring a lever or change to attach the generator to the specified circuits. Whereas inexpensive upfront, guide switches require person intervention throughout energy outages, probably delaying energy restoration. Any such change is mostly appropriate for smaller mills and fewer important functions.

  • Computerized Switch Switches

    Computerized switch switches present seamless energy switch throughout outages. They mechanically detect an influence loss, begin the generator, and switch {the electrical} load with out guide intervention. Whereas costlier than guide switches, computerized switch switches supply better comfort and quicker energy restoration, making them appropriate for bigger mills and demanding functions the place uninterrupted energy is important. Computerized switch switches additional subdivide into open and closed transition varieties, with closed transition switches providing a cleaner, faster energy switch, however at the next price.

  • Service-Rated Switch Switches

    Service-rated switch switches handle the complete electrical load of a house or enterprise, together with all circuits. These switches are important for bigger mills designed for whole-house backup energy. Their greater capability and extra advanced set up contribute to the next total price in comparison with switch switches designed for partial-house protection. Service-rated switch switches present complete safety towards energy outages, making certain all important methods stay operational.

  • Load-Shedding Switch Switches

    Load-shedding switch switches intelligently handle energy distribution throughout an outage. They prioritize important circuits whereas mechanically disconnecting much less important masses to forestall generator overload. This function permits for the usage of a smaller, inexpensive generator whereas making certain important home equipment and methods obtain energy. The superior performance of load-shedding switch switches usually comes at the next worth in comparison with normal switch switches, however the potential financial savings on generator dimension can offset this price distinction in some situations.

6. Upkeep Contracts

Upkeep contracts symbolize a major issue influencing the long-term price of Generac generator possession. Common upkeep ensures optimum efficiency, prolongs lifespan, and might forestall pricey repairs. Evaluating the varied upkeep contract choices out there helps shoppers perceive their impression on the general price of proudly owning and working a Generac generator.

  • Contract Protection

    Upkeep contracts differ when it comes to protection. Some contracts cowl solely routine inspections and fundamental upkeep duties, equivalent to oil and filter modifications, whereas others supply extra complete protection, together with elements alternative and emergency service. The scope of protection instantly impacts the contract worth and the potential for out-of-pocket bills for repairs not lined beneath the contract. A contract overlaying solely fundamental upkeep would possibly supply decrease upfront prices however may depart the proprietor liable for costlier repairs down the road. Complete contracts supply better safety however usually come at the next worth.

  • Contract Period

    Upkeep contract durations usually vary from one to a number of years. Longer contracts typically present discounted pricing in comparison with shorter-term agreements. Selecting an extended contract can supply price financial savings over time however requires a bigger upfront funding. Shorter contracts present better flexibility however would possibly end in greater total upkeep bills over the long run. The selection of contract length is dependent upon particular person budgetary constraints and the specified degree of price predictability.

  • Included Providers

    Particular providers included in a upkeep contract differ relying on the supplier and the chosen contract degree. Frequent providers embody routine inspections, oil and filter modifications, spark plug alternative, air filter cleansing, and system testing. Some contracts may also embody gasoline system upkeep, coolant checks, and battery testing. Understanding the precise providers included in every contract helps assess its worth and evaluate it to the price of acquiring these providers individually. Contracts with extra inclusive service choices usually command greater costs however can supply better worth and comfort.

  • Preventative Upkeep Advantages

    Investing in a upkeep contract emphasizes preventative upkeep, contributing to the long-term well being and reliability of the generator. Common upkeep, as outlined in a contract, helps establish potential points early, stopping extra intensive and dear repairs down the road. Whereas a upkeep contract provides to the upfront price of generator possession, it might probably considerably scale back the danger of surprising breakdowns and costly repairs, in the end contributing to decrease total possession prices and better peace of thoughts.
